| Line item | Three months ended June 30, 2026 | Three months ended June 30, 2025 | Six months ended June 30, 2026 | Six months ended June 30, 2025 |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Revenues: | ||||
| Direct premiums | $877,754 | $866,254 | $1,748,999 | $1,725,099 |
| Ceded premiums | (442,280) | (433,408) | (857,139) | (843,930) |
| Net premiums | 435,474 | 432,846 | 891,860 | 881,169 |
| Commissions and fees | 368,610 | 306,032 | 725,352 | 602,988 |
| Investment income net of investment expenses | 56,600 | 55,549 | 113,106 | 111,888 |
| Interest expense on surplus note | (12,862) | (14,621) | (26,085) | (29,289) |
| Net investment income | 43,738 | 40,928 | 87,021 | 82,599 |

FAQ
- What is Primerica's net premiums written?
- Primerica (PRI) reported net premiums written of $435.47M in Q2 2026.
- How has Primerica's net premiums written changed year-over-year?
- Primerica's net premiums written increased by 0.6% year-over-year, from $432.85M to $435.47M.
- What is the long-term trend for Primerica's net premiums written?
- Over 4 years (2021 to 2025), Primerica's net premiums written has grown at a 4.3%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$1.51B to $1.78B.
- What does net premiums written mean?
- Calculated as direct premiums written minus ceded premiums, this represents the actual premium revenue retained by the company after accounting for reinsurance. It is a key measure of the company's core underwriting business and revenue-generating capacity.
